btw, this battery is 1390 mah, not 1300 as it's listed in title and description.



5$ for a battery that cost 50$ from "Official" Markets like Verizon & Retail Chains? definitely sounded too good to be true. But I thought, what the hell, for 5$, I'll give it a shot, and from some scattered reviews, they seem to be satisfied that it's likely OEM w slight differences. And if Amazon Direct had once sold it for 5$ as well, then 5$ from private amazon sellers no longer sounded so far fetched.



There were slight differences in what I received compared to the "GENUINE MOTOROLA" that came w my phone so i DID question it's authenticity. The font size on these spare batteries were slightly larger on the front. and there are slight differences in placement of information on the back of the battery. Otherwise all the info and branding is the same, even with the same holographic prism across the back.

**btw, the photo in this listing is of the OEM Stock battery that came with our USA phones, NOT the version we'll be receiving.



I later came to feel more secure with my purchase from private sellers after my brother bought his Droid2Global phone. Since his phone is considered a "Global" product, all his included accesories included outlet adapters, etc. and when I looked at his battery, sure enough, it looked EXACTLY the same as the ones I buy off amazon sellers.



So the conclusion is:

-the batteries from the amazon marketplace are indeed OEM, but they're GLOBAL OEM inventory. if it matters to anyone, there's probably slight differences between USA Standards and Global Standards. But for most of us, as long as it's officially OEM, it's good enough for us.

The fact that the seller's description includes "ONLY trust your phone with Motorola OEM ORIGINAL batteries!" and included a photo of an original Motorola batter led me to believe I was purchasing a legitimate battery. Not so. Received a little, dirty, damaged blue box labeled "Mini Digital Video Battery". The battery is the same size as the Droid battery, but it is certainly not the same. There is no "Motorola" anywhere on it. There are also misspellings on the battery. Apparently it is a 3.7V lithium ion BOLYMER battery. I don't know if it works or not. It very well may, but I personally am not going to risk putting some random piece of crap video camera battery in my phone.
